At the heart of LA’s wholesale clothing scene lies the Fashion District, a bustling marketplace that spans over 100 blocks. Here, retailers can find everything from high-end apparel to budget-friendly options.
The district is home to thousands of showrooms and manufacturers, making it easy for buyers to source a wide variety of styles. With an extensive range of products available, businesses can quickly adapt to changing trends and consumer demands.
The Fashion District also fosters a community of designers, manufacturers, and retailers, creating ample networking opportunities. Trade shows and fashion events are frequently held in this area, allowing industry professionals to connect, collaborate, and discover new trends. This sense of community is invaluable for emerging designers looking to establish their brands in a competitive market.

One of the advantages of Los Angeles is its strategic location on the West Coast. The city is easily accessible to major markets across the United States and even internationally. This geographic advantage makes it convenient for retailers to import goods from Asia and other countries, reducing shipping times and costs.
LA boasts a well-established supply chain that supports the wholesale clothing industry. With numerous transportation options, including ports, airports, and highways, businesses can efficiently manage their logistics. This efficiency ensures that retailers receive their products promptly, allowing them to respond quickly to consumer demands.
